Prof. Ziobro Hosts “Meet the Bruce Springsteen Archives” Event Sept. 5

Melissa Ziobro, curator for the Bruce Springsteen Archives and Center for American Music and adjunct professor of public history, will discuss the Archives at an event held at the Monmouth County Library Eastern Branch on Thursday, Sept. 5 at 1:30 p.m. Guests must register for this in-person program to reserve seating.

Ziobro will present an overview of the collection's history, programmatic and exhibition efforts to date, and an inside look at ongoing efforts to stage a major traveling exhibit while planning for a museum opening in 2026.

The Bruce Springsteen Archives & Center for American Music (BSACAM) at Monmouth University preserves the legacy of Bruce Springsteen and celebrates the history of American music and its diversity of artists and genres. The collection holds close to 50,000 items dating from 1927 to the present. Monmouth University recently announced a new 30,000 square foot building to house the Archives, related exhibition galleries, and a 230 seat, state-of-the-art theater
